Output 58d8681a06f12c790ec3ce12e4c30c167d21d9c9199aa62253b6119ad721437d:5

value
215162871
script pubkey
OP_0 OP_PUSHBYTES_20 1659431e060b8d442a40e5660cecb00ed2e4abd8
address
bc1qzev5x8sxpwx5g2jqu4nqem9spmfwf27cy4nz3d
transaction
58d8681a06f12c790ec3ce12e4c30c167d21d9c9199aa62253b6119ad721437d
confirmations
309056
spent
true